A proposal is essentially a suggestion or plan put forward for consideration and decision.

Understanding the Concept of a Proposal

Based on the provided definition, a proposal is a plan or an idea, often a formal or written one, which is suggested for people to think about and decide upon. It's a formal way of putting forward a concept, project, or solution with the intention of gaining approval, feedback, or action.

Proposals serve as the foundation for initiating projects, securing funding, or resolving issues by clearly outlining:

  • The problem or opportunity
  • The suggested plan or idea
  • The potential outcomes or benefits

Practical Examples

Proposals are used in various contexts. The reference provides an example:

  • Policy Context: "The President is to put forward new proposals for resolving the country's constitutional crisis." This demonstrates how proposals are used at a high level to suggest solutions to significant problems.

Other common types include:

  • Business Proposals: Submitted to clients to win new business.
  • Project Proposals: Presented internally to get approval for new initiatives.
  • Grant Proposals: Written to request funding for research or projects.
  • Research Proposals: Outlining planned academic or scientific studies.

In summary, a proposal is the formal presentation of an idea or plan intended for evaluation and decision-making by others.
